Rotomag Enertec acquires stake in Statcon Energiaa

Rotomag Enertec Limited has purchased a 50.99 per cent stake in Statcon Energiaa Private Limited. The partnership will focus on developing megawatt-scale battery energy storage systems (BESS) and increasing the production of domestically manufactured solar inverters.

The companies also plan joint research and development on advanced energy solutions using lithium-ion batteries. They aim to expand operations into markets across Asia, Africa, and the Middle East.

Statcon Energiaa, according to its press release, is the first Indian company to fully design, manufacture, and sell on-grid solar inverters. Its product range also includes power converters for green hydrogen, defence, railways, and the power sector. The company recently signed a deal with AEG PS, Germany, targeting the green hydrogen rectifier market in India.

The collaboration will focus on the development of next-generation MW-BESS solutions, scaling production of indigenised hybrid and three-phase on-grid solar inverters, advancing green hydrogen rectifiers, joint R&D on lithium-ion battery solutions, and expanding into international markets.
